REYES, Cesar Jr., 46, of Tampa, died Thursday, February 24, 2011. He issurvived by his wife, Jacqueline Reyes; two daughters, Madison and Emma Reyes; mother, Betty Diaz; father, Cesar Reyes Sr.; sister, Alma Reyes; and brother, Tomas Reyes.
